What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(4): Ladder(s) were used for purposes other than the purpose for which they were designed:   a) An employee was observed standing 6 feet 2 inches above a concrete sidewalk on a 10 foot portable step ladder in the folded position, outside in the front of the building, on or about 06/05/13.

29 CFR 1926.1060(a): The employer did not provide a training program for each employee using ladders and stairways, as necessary, which would enable each employee to recognize hazards related to ladders and stairways and train each employee in the procedures to be followed to minimize these hazards:  a) Employees were not provided with ladder training as evidenced by observed hazards on or about 06/05/13.    Abatement certification required within 10 days after abatement date. The certification shall include a statement that abatement is complete, date and method of abatement, and states employees and their representatives were informed of this abatement.
